BLUEBERRY MUFFINS



Blueberry Muffins image

This easy Blueberry Muffin recipe is to die for! They are super moist and fluffy. It's topped with a crumbly streusel topping that is made from scratch.

Provided by Dina

Categories     Dessert

Number Of Ingredients 16

2 cup all-purpose flour
1 tsp baking powder
1/2 tsp baking soda
1/4 tsp salt
3 eggs
1 cup granulated sugar
1 tsp vanilla extract
1 tbsp lemon juice
3/4 cup heavy cream
4 tbsp unsalted melted butter
1 1/2 cup blueberries
1 tbsp unsalted butter (cold)
2.5-3.0 tbsp all-purpose flour
3 tbsp brown sugar
Pinch salt
1 tsp cinnamon

Steps:

  • Start off by combining all of your dry ingredients in a bowl. Add 2 cups of all-purpose flour, 1 tsp baking powder, 1/2 tsp baking soda, and 1/4 tsp salt, then whisk it together.
  • Reserve about 1 tbsp of the flour mixture and mix it with 1 1/2 cups of blueberries. Then set it aside.
  • Now add 3 eggs into a large bowl and whisk them on high speed with an electric hand mixer. You want to whisk them for a few minutes until the eggs become pale and fluffy.
  • Then continue beating the eggs as you add in 1 cup of granulated sugar. Keep beating for about 3 more minutes. The key to super fluffy muffins is well-beaten eggs.
  • Now add 1 tsp vanilla extract and 1 tbsp lemon juice.
  • Beat the eggs on high speed again and this time slowly add in 3/4 cup heavy cream.
  • Now you can begin sifting in your dry ingredients. But don't add it in all at once. You'll want to add about 1/3 of the dry ingredients at a time with mixing in between.
  • Once you've got all your dry ingredients well Incorporated continue mixing as you add in 4 tbsp of unsalted melted butter.
  • Now add the blueberries to the blueberry muffin batter.
  • Fold the blueberries into the batter using a spatula. Now Line your muffin tin with cupcake liners and begin scooping the batter out using a large cookie scoop.
  • Make the streusel topping by combing 1 tbsp unsalted cold cubed butter, 2 tbsp all-purpose flour, Pinch of salt, 1 tsp cinnamon, and 3 tbsp brown sugar in a small bowl.
  • Mash it all together using a fork until all the ingredients are well combined and have a crumbly dry texture to them.
  • Now top the blueberry muffins with the streusel topping and bake them in the oven at 350 degrees Fahrenheit for about 35 minutes.

TO DIE FOR BLUEBERRY MUFFINS



To Die for Blueberry Muffins image

These muffins are extra large and yummy with the sugary-cinnamon crumb topping. I usually double the recipe and fill the muffin cups just to the top edge for a wonderful extra-generously-sized deli style muffin. Add extra blueberries too, if you want!

Provided by xonexhotxblondex

Categories     Quick Breads

Time 40m

Yield 8 Muffins

Number Of Ingredients 12

1 1/2 cups all-purpose flour
3/4 cup white sugar
1/2 teaspoon salt
2 teaspoons baking powder
1/3 cup vegetable oil
1 egg
1/3 cup milk
1 cup fresh blueberries
1/2 cup white sugar
1/3 cup all-purpose flour
1/4 cup butter, cubed
1 1/2 teaspoons ground cinnamon

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 400 degrees F (200 degrees C). Grease muffin cups or line with muffin liners.
  • Combine 1 1/2 cups flour, 3/4 cup sugar, salt and baking powder. Place vegetable oil into a 1 cup measuring cup; add the egg and enough milk to fill the cup. Mix this with flour mixture. Fold in blueberries. Fill muffin cups right to the top, and sprinkle with crumb topping mixture.
  • To Make Crumb Topping: Mix together 1/2 cup sugar, 1/3 cup flour, 1/4 cup butter, and 1 1/2 teaspoons cinnamon. Mix with fork, and sprinkle over muffins before baking.
  • Bake for 20 to 25 minutes in the preheated oven, or until done.

HEALTHIER TO DIE FOR BLUEBERRY MUFFINS



Healthier To Die For Blueberry Muffins image

These muffins are so good. I double the blueberries. They are so full of antioxidants and vitamins that you can never have enough. And they taste so good.

Provided by MakeItHealthy

Categories     Bread     Quick Bread Recipes     Muffin Recipes     Blueberry Muffin Recipes

Time 40m

Yield 8

Number Of Ingredients 11

½ cup white sugar
⅓ cup all-purpose flour
¼ cup butter, cubed
1 ½ teaspoons ground cinnamon
1 ½ cups all-purpose flour
¾ cup white sugar
2 teaspoons baking powder
⅓ cup applesauce
1 egg
⅓ cup milk
2 cups fresh blueberries

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 400 degrees F (200 degrees C). Lightly grease muffin cups or line with muffin liners.
  • Mix together 1/2 cup sugar, 1/3 cup flour, 1/4 cup butter, cinnamon in a small bowl with a fork until mixture resembles a coarse crumb.
  • Combine 1 1/2 cups flour, 3/4 cup sugar, and baking powder in a bowl. Place applesauce into a 1 cup measuring cup; add egg and enough milk to fill cup; mix into flour mixture. Fold in blueberries. Fill muffin cups to the top, and sprinkle with crumb topping mixture.
  • Bake in the preheated oven until golden and the tops spring back when lightly pressed, 20 to 25 minutes.
